1.1a – Goal Setting


Green Development Goals
Preservation and structural repair of a 1956 midcentury modern ranch house, previously abandoned, severely
dilapidated, and slated to be torn down. Goal is to preserve the existing neighborhood fabric while adding high-
quality housing stock to Cleveland. This kind of project can serve as an example to other builders how Cleveland’s
existing architecturally rich housing stock can be not only preserved, but upgraded for the future.

Integrative Design Process


Web of communication between Contractor, Green Verifier, Green Records Keeper, Design Manual, and City.

Contractor and Green Records Keeper communicate regularly to make sure materials and construction processes
are compliant throughout the design/build process. Green Records Keeper deeply researches the Manual; Green
Records Keeper is in contact with the City to verify what best practices are - e.g. how the information should be
presented for the City to best conduct its assessment, checking to make sure everything is compliant. Green
Records Keeper asks Green Verifier about any ambiguous criteria and uses the Verifier’s guidance to make sure
everything is covered. Contractor and Green Verifier coordinate any record keeping work that requires an outside
contractor.
Measure Against Goals
All parties involved form a web of communication, mutual verification, and record keeping.

Designing architect is also owner's representative during construction phase - original design team intimately
involved with construction. Record-keeper will be in regular contact with contractor to make sure that permissible
materials are used throughout construction, waste disposal strategies are followed.

1.3b – Hazard Risk Assessment


Vulnerability to high winds and extreme temperatures
11208 Lake Avenue is in a location subject to high winds and stormy weather, due to its close proximity to Lake
Erie.
Metal roof - resists wind, debris damage.
Masonry construction - resists wind, pest damage.
Modern insulation - resists extreme temperature and humidity swings.
